What Is the Current State of Crypto Regulation in Colombia?

Crypto is legal in Colombia, but it is not recognized as legal tender. Over the past few years, the Colombian government has taken steps to regulate digital assets through the Superintendencia Financiera de Colombia (SFC).

The SFC launched a regulatory sandbox allowing exchanges like Bitso and Bybit to integrate with Colombia’s national banking system. However, there is still no formal licensing framework for crypto exchanges. Despite this, all platforms must comply with strict AML and KYC regulations.

Do I Have to Pay Tax on Crypto Trades in Colombia?

Yes. The Dirección de Impuestos y Aduanas Nacionales (DIAN) treats crypto assets as taxable property.

  • Capital Gains Tax applies to long-term holders who sell crypto for COP, generally at a flat rate of 10%.
  • Income Tax applies to earnings from active trading, mining, and staking, with progressive rates ranging from 0% to 39%, depending on income.

Traders are responsible for self-reporting all activity, including keeping accurate records of trades, values in COP, and dates.

How to Choose a Safe Crypto Exchange in Colombia?

As there is no formal legal framework for exchanges, consider the following when choosing an exchange:

  • SFC Sandbox Participation: Check if the exchange participates in the SFC’s pilot program. This information is available on the SFC website and ensures exchanges comply with Colombian financial regulations.
  • Global Reputation: Look for large, globally recognized exchanges with established track records.
  • Robust Security Measures: Ensure the exchange offers essential security features, including 2FA, biometric authentication, withdrawal whitelisting, and cold storage of user assets.
  • Transparent Proof of Reserves: Choose platforms providing detailed Proof of Reserves along with transparent security audits.

Is P2P Trading Available in Colombia for Buying Crypto?

Yes, P2P trading is widely available and extremely popular in Colombia. It is one of the preferred methods of buying crypto with COP, due to the limited support for traditional payment methods.

Platforms like Bybit, KuCoin, and OKX let users buy and sell crypto safely with escrow protection and verified merchants.

What Common Crypto Scams Target Users in Colombia?

The most common scams affecting Colombian users include:

  • Fake investment platforms promising guaranteed returns.
  • Ponzi schemes disguised as crypto projects.
  • Phishing and imposter accounts posing as official exchange representatives.
  • P2P fraud, such as fake payment confirmations or reversed transactions.

Always verify the identity of P2P merchants and only use platforms that offer escrow protection.
